Transaction 34d33c214845bfc76ef6ee7d62b7bb57edd389c9d67699de13eaef2dbc07e264
1 Input
2 Outputs
- 34d33c214845bfc76ef6ee7d62b7bb57edd389c9d67699de13eaef2dbc07e264:0
- 34d33c214845bfc76ef6ee7d62b7bb57edd389c9d67699de13eaef2dbc07e264:1
value 15000000
address 162Lgnpp1bTeroAZwS2MzFG5KupSbeat2s
value 1858869315
address 18DkX8BmdAbJGEru6gSrjwwPhE67N7W9oN